I don't have any of these parts to sell currently, unfortunately.  I too have a '77 and the previous owner replaced all of the plastic with Vantage Plane Plastics parts.  They fit OK, and required a LOT of trimming and fitting.  I'm planning to replace all of the upper stuff with pieces from my '81 salvage J that has the better ventilation system.  If your stuff is in poor shape, and if you're handy, I'd recommend trying to do the same thing because you'll end up with much better ventilation, less drag, and less noise on the roof.  A poster here (Eldon) might still have some of these components for sale.  I was going to buy them before I got my salvage plane 2 years ago.  Otherwise, try LASAR or some salvage yards here.  Good luck!
